Q4 and full-year 2025 saw revenue and EPS surge, led by CED segment growth and robust demand across all regions. The announced $1.5B acquisition of Renesas' timing business is set to nearly double CED revenue, boost margins, and accelerate long-term growth.

Q3 2025 saw 45% year-over-year revenue growth to $83.6M, with CED segment up 115% and gross margin at 58.8%. Q4 guidance projects $100–$103M revenue and 60–60.5% gross margin, driven by strong AI and data center demand. Titan platform launch expands future market reach.
-
Q2 2025 revenue surged 58% year-over-year to $69.5 million, led by 137% growth in the AI-driven data center segment. Gross margin expanded to 58.2%, and guidance calls for continued sequential growth and at least 40% annual revenue growth, supported by strong bookings and new product momentum.
-
Q1 2025 revenue surged 83% year-over-year to $60.3 million, led by robust growth in data center and communications segments. Gross margin was 57.4%, and strong design wins position all segments for continued expansion, with a 25%-30% full-year growth target reaffirmed.

Q4 2024 revenue rose 61% year-over-year, with all segments showing double-digit growth and CED up 156%. Full-year revenue grew 41% to $202.7M, with strong profitability and cash flow. 2025 outlook is positive, targeting 25–30% growth and continued margin improvement.

Q3 revenue surged 62% year-over-year to $57.7 million, with CED sales up 233% and net income at 17% of revenue. Q4 guidance projects continued growth, led by CED and consumer IoT/mobile, and a long-term gross margin target above 60% by late 2025.
-
Q2 revenue surged 58% year-over-year to $43.9M, with all segments growing and CED tracking above 70% growth. Strong bookings and new product ramps, especially in AI and data center, are expected to drive further sequential growth and margin improvement in the coming quarters.
